Southampton WILL continue to receive team kits despite issues with Hummel’s UK distribution that has seen club stocks impacted and Bristol City terminate their contract with the Danish sportswear company

Southampton have received reassurances they will have no supply issues after their kit manufacturers’ UK distributor went into administration. Fellow Hummel-sponsored side, Bristol City, brought a premature end to their six-year agreement with the Danish sportswear company last week after distributor Elite Sports Group hit financial trouble at the back end of last year. West Ham’s Lukasz Fabianski is facing a long spell on the sidelines after suffering a fractured cheekbone and eye-socket in their win over Nottingham Forest… with the Polish goalkeeper possibly requiring surgery

West Ham goalkeeper Lukasz Fabianski is set for a long spell on the sidelines after suffering a horror facial injury. The Polish veteran may require surgery after he sustained a fractured cheekbone and eye socket against Nottingham Forest on Saturday.
